using System.Collections;
using System.Collections.Generic;
using UnityEngine;
using UnityEditor;
using System.Reflection;
using System;
public class SerializableDictionaryPropertyDrawer : PropertyDrawer
{
const string KeysFieldName = "m_keys";
const string ValuesFieldName = "m_values";
protected const float IndentWidth = 15f;
static GUIContent s_iconPlus = IconContent ("Toolbar Plus", "Add entry");
static GUIContent s_iconMinus = IconContent ("Toolbar Minus", "Remove entry");
static GUIContent s_warningIconConflict = IconContent ("console.warnicon.sml", "Conflicting key, this entry will be lost");
static GUIContent s_warningIconOther = IconContent ("console.infoicon.sml", "Conflicting key");
static GUIContent s_warningIconNull = IconContent ("console.warnicon.sml", "Null key, this entry will be lost");
static GUIStyle s_buttonStyle = GUIStyle.none;
static GUIContent s_tempContent = new GUIContent();
class ConflictState
{
public object conflictKey = null;
public object conflictValue = null;
public int conflictIndex = -1 ;
public int conflictOtherIndex = -1 ;
public bool conflictKeyPropertyExpanded = false;
public bool conflictValuePropertyExpanded = false;
public float conflictLineHeight = 0f;
}
struct PropertyIdentity
{
public PropertyIdentity(SerializedProperty property)
{
this.instance = property.serializedObject.targetObject;
this.propertyPath = property.propertyPath;
}
public UnityEngine.Object instance;
public string propertyPath;
}
static Dictionary<PropertyIdentity, ConflictState> s_conflictStateDict = new Dictionary<PropertyIdentity, ConflictState>();
enum Action
{
None,
Add,
Remove
}
public override void OnGUI(Rect position, SerializedProperty property, GUIContent label)
{
label = EditorGUI.BeginProperty(position, label, property);
Action buttonAction = Action.None;
int buttonActionIndex = 0;
var keyArrayProperty = property.FindPropertyRelative(KeysFieldName);
var valueArrayProperty = property.FindPropertyRelative(ValuesFieldName);
ConflictState conflictState = GetConflictState(property);
if(conflictState.conflictIndex != -1)
{
keyArrayProperty.InsertArrayElementAtIndex(conflictState.conflictIndex);
var keyProperty = keyArrayProperty.GetArrayElementAtIndex(conflictState.conflictIndex);
SetPropertyValue(keyProperty, conflictState.conflictKey);
keyProperty.isExpanded = conflictState.conflictKeyPropertyExpanded;
valueArrayProperty.InsertArrayElementAtIndex(conflictState.conflictIndex);
var valueProperty = valueArrayProperty.GetArrayElementAtIndex(conflictState.conflictIndex);
SetPropertyValue(valueProperty, conflictState.conflictValue);
valueProperty.isExpanded = conflictState.conflictValuePropertyExpanded;
}
var buttonWidth = s_buttonStyle.CalcSize(s_iconPlus).x;
var labelPosition = position;
labelPosition.height = EditorGUIUtility.singleLineHeight;
if (property.isExpanded)
labelPosition.xMax -= s_buttonStyle.CalcSize(s_iconPlus).x;
EditorGUI.PropertyField(labelPosition, property, label, false);
//property.isExpanded = EditorGUI.Foldout(labelPosition, property.isExpanded, label);
if (property.isExpanded)
{
var buttonPosition = position;
buttonPosition.xMin = buttonPosition.xMax - buttonWidth;
buttonPosition.height = EditorGUIUtility.singleLineHeight;
EditorGUI.BeginDisabledGroup(conflictState.conflictIndex != -1);
if(GUI.Button(buttonPosition, s_iconPlus, s_buttonStyle))
{
buttonAction = Action.Add;
buttonActionIndex = keyArrayProperty.arraySize;
}
EditorGUI.EndDisabledGroup();
EditorGUI.indentLevel++;
var linePosition = position;
linePosition.y += EditorGUIUtility.singleLineHeight;
linePosition.xMax -= buttonWidth;
foreach(var entry in EnumerateEntries(keyArrayProperty, valueArrayProperty))
{
var keyProperty = entry.keyProperty;
var valueProperty = entry.valueProperty;
int i = entry.index;
float lineHeight = DrawKeyValueLine(keyProperty, valueProperty, linePosition, i);
buttonPosition = linePosition;
buttonPosition.x = linePosition.xMax;
buttonPosition.height = EditorGUIUtility.singleLineHeight;
if(GUI.Button(buttonPosition, s_iconMinus, s_buttonStyle))
{
buttonAction = Action.Remove;
buttonActionIndex = i;
}
if(i == conflictState.conflictIndex && conflictState.conflictOtherIndex == -1)
{
var iconPosition = linePosition;
iconPosition.size = s_buttonStyle.CalcSize(s_warningIconNull);
GUI.Label(iconPosition, s_warningIconNull);
}
else if(i == conflictState.conflictIndex)
{
var iconPosition = linePosition;
iconPosition.size = s_buttonStyle.CalcSize(s_warningIconConflict);
GUI.Label(iconPosition, s_warningIconConflict);
}
else if(i == conflictState.conflictOtherIndex)
{
var iconPosition = linePosition;
iconPosition.size = s_buttonStyle.CalcSize(s_warningIconOther);
GUI.Label(iconPosition, s_warningIconOther);
}
linePosition.y += lineHeight;
}
EditorGUI.indentLevel--;
}
if(buttonAction == Action.Add)
{
keyArrayProperty.InsertArrayElementAtIndex(buttonActionIndex);
valueArrayProperty.InsertArrayElementAtIndex(buttonActionIndex);
}
else if(buttonAction == Action.Remove)
{
DeleteArrayElementAtIndex(keyArrayProperty, buttonActionIndex);
DeleteArrayElementAtIndex(valueArrayProperty, buttonActionIndex);
}
conflictState.conflictKey = null;
conflictState.conflictValue = null;
conflictState.conflictIndex = -1;
conflictState.conflictOtherIndex = -1;
conflictState.conflictLineHeight = 0f;
conflictState.conflictKeyPropertyExpanded = false;
conflictState.conflictValuePropertyExpanded = false;
foreach(var entry1 in EnumerateEntries(keyArrayProperty, valueArrayProperty))
{
var keyProperty1 = entry1.keyProperty;
int i = entry1.index;
object keyProperty1Value = GetPropertyValue(keyProperty1);
if(keyProperty1Value == null)
{
var valueProperty1 = entry1.valueProperty;
SaveProperty(keyProperty1, valueProperty1, i, -1, conflictState);
DeleteArrayElementAtIndex(valueArrayProperty, i);
DeleteArrayElementAtIndex(keyArrayProperty, i);
break;
}
foreach(var entry2 in EnumerateEntries(keyArrayProperty, valueArrayProperty, i + 1))
{
var keyProperty2 = entry2.keyProperty;
int j = entry2.index;
object keyProperty2Value = GetPropertyValue(keyProperty2);
if(ComparePropertyValues(keyProperty1Value, keyProperty2Value))
{
var valueProperty2 = entry2.valueProperty;
SaveProperty(keyProperty2, valueProperty2, j, i, conflictState);
DeleteArrayElementAtIndex(keyArrayProperty, j);
DeleteArrayElementAtIndex(valueArrayProperty, j);
goto breakLoops;
}
}
}
breakLoops:
EditorGUI.EndProperty();
}
static float DrawKeyValueLine(SerializedProperty keyProperty, SerializedProperty valueProperty, Rect linePosition, int index)
{
bool keyCanBeExpanded = CanPropertyBeExpanded(keyProperty);
bool valueCanBeExpanded = CanPropertyBeExpanded(valueProperty);
if(!keyCanBeExpanded && valueCanBeExpanded)
{
return DrawKeyValueLineExpand(keyProperty, valueProperty, linePosition);
}
else
{
var keyLabel = keyCanBeExpanded ? ("Key " + index.ToString()) : "";
var valueLabel = valueCanBeExpanded ? ("Value " + index.ToString()) : "";
return DrawKeyValueLineSimple(keyProperty, valueProperty, keyLabel, valueLabel, linePosition);
}
}
static float DrawKeyValueLineSimple(SerializedProperty keyProperty, SerializedProperty valueProperty, string keyLabel, string valueLabel, Rect linePosition)
{
float labelWidth = EditorGUIUtility.labelWidth;
float labelWidthRelative = labelWidth / linePosition.width;
float keyPropertyHeight = EditorGUI.GetPropertyHeight(keyProperty);
var keyPosition = linePosition;
keyPosition.height = keyPropertyHeight;
keyPosition.width = labelWidth - IndentWidth;
EditorGUIUtility.labelWidth = keyPosition.width * labelWidthRelative;
EditorGUI.PropertyField(keyPosition, keyProperty, TempContent(keyLabel), true);
float valuePropertyHeight = EditorGUI.GetPropertyHeight(valueProperty);
var valuePosition = linePosition;
valuePosition.height = valuePropertyHeight;
valuePosition.xMin += labelWidth;
EditorGUIUtility.labelWidth = valuePosition.width * labelWidthRelative;
EditorGUI.indentLevel--;
EditorGUI.PropertyField(valuePosition, valueProperty, TempContent(valueLabel), true);
EditorGUI.indentLevel++;
EditorGUIUtility.labelWidth = labelWidth;
return Mathf.Max(keyPropertyHeight, valuePropertyHeight);
}
static float DrawKeyValueLineExpand(SerializedProperty keyProperty, SerializedProperty valueProperty, Rect linePosition)
{
float labelWidth = EditorGUIUtility.labelWidth;
float keyPropertyHeight = EditorGUI.GetPropertyHeight(keyProperty);
var keyPosition = linePosition;
keyPosition.height = keyPropertyHeight;
keyPosition.width = labelWidth - IndentWidth;
keyPosition.x += 15;
EditorGUI.PropertyField(keyPosition, keyProperty, GUIContent.none, true);
float valuePropertyHeight = EditorGUI.GetPropertyHeight(valueProperty);
var valuePosition = linePosition;
valuePosition.height = valuePropertyHeight;
EditorGUI.PropertyField(valuePosition, valueProperty, GUIContent.none, true);
EditorGUIUtility.labelWidth = labelWidth;
return Mathf.Max(keyPropertyHeight, valuePropertyHeight);
}
static bool CanPropertyBeExpanded(SerializedProperty property)
{
switch(property.propertyType)
{
case SerializedPropertyType.Generic:
case SerializedPropertyType.Vector4:
case SerializedPropertyType.Quaternion:
return true;
default:
return false;
}
}
static void SaveProperty(SerializedProperty keyProperty, SerializedProperty valueProperty, int index, int otherIndex, ConflictState conflictState)
{
conflictState.conflictKey = GetPropertyValue(keyProperty);
conflictState.conflictValue = GetPropertyValue(valueProperty);
float keyPropertyHeight = EditorGUI.GetPropertyHeight(keyProperty);
float valuePropertyHeight = EditorGUI.GetPropertyHeight(valueProperty);
float lineHeight = Mathf.Max(keyPropertyHeight, valuePropertyHeight);
conflictState.conflictLineHeight = lineHeight;
conflictState.conflictIndex = index;
conflictState.conflictOtherIndex = otherIndex;
conflictState.conflictKeyPropertyExpanded = keyProperty.isExpanded;
conflictState.conflictValuePropertyExpanded = valueProperty.isExpanded;
}
public override float GetPropertyHeight(SerializedProperty property, GUIContent label)
{
float propertyHeight = EditorGUIUtility.singleLineHeight;
if (property.isExpanded)
{
var keysProperty = property.FindPropertyRelative(KeysFieldName);
var valuesProperty = property.FindPropertyRelative(ValuesFieldName);
foreach(var entry in EnumerateEntries(keysProperty, valuesProperty))
{
var keyProperty = entry.keyProperty;
var valueProperty = entry.valueProperty;
float keyPropertyHeight = EditorGUI.GetPropertyHeight(keyProperty);
float valuePropertyHeight = EditorGUI.GetPropertyHeight(valueProperty);
float lineHeight = Mathf.Max(keyPropertyHeight, valuePropertyHeight);
propertyHeight += lineHeight;
}
ConflictState conflictState = GetConflictState(property);
if(conflictState.conflictIndex != -1)
{
propertyHeight += conflictState.conflictLineHeight;
}
}
return propertyHeight;
}
static ConflictState GetConflictState(SerializedProperty property)
{
ConflictState conflictState;
PropertyIdentity propId = new PropertyIdentity(property);
if(!s_conflictStateDict.TryGetValue(propId, out conflictState))
{
conflictState = new ConflictState();
s_conflictStateDict.Add(propId, conflictState);
}
return conflictState;
}
static Dictionary<SerializedPropertyType, PropertyInfo> s_serializedPropertyValueAccessorsDict;
static SerializableDictionaryPropertyDrawer()
{
Dictionary<SerializedPropertyType, string> serializedPropertyValueAccessorsNameDict = new Dictionary<SerializedPropertyType, string>() {
{ SerializedPropertyType.Integer, "intValue" },
{ SerializedPropertyType.Boolean, "boolValue" },
{ SerializedPropertyType.Float, "floatValue" },
{ SerializedPropertyType.String, "stringValue" },
{ SerializedPropertyType.Color, "colorValue" },
{ SerializedPropertyType.ObjectReference, "objectReferenceValue" },
{ SerializedPropertyType.LayerMask, "intValue" },
{ SerializedPropertyType.Enum, "intValue" },
{ SerializedPropertyType.Vector2, "vector2Value" },
{ SerializedPropertyType.Vector3, "vector3Value" },
{ SerializedPropertyType.Vector4, "vector4Value" },
{ SerializedPropertyType.Rect, "rectValue" },
{ SerializedPropertyType.ArraySize, "intValue" },
{ SerializedPropertyType.Character, "intValue" },
{ SerializedPropertyType.AnimationCurve, "animationCurveValue" },
{ SerializedPropertyType.Bounds, "boundsValue" },
{ SerializedPropertyType.Quaternion, "quaternionValue" },
};
Type serializedPropertyType = typeof(SerializedProperty);
s_serializedPropertyValueAccessorsDict = new Dictionary<SerializedPropertyType, PropertyInfo>();
BindingFlags flags = BindingFlags.Instance | BindingFlags.Public;
foreach(var kvp in serializedPropertyValueAccessorsNameDict)
{
PropertyInfo propertyInfo = serializedPropertyType.GetProperty(kvp.Value, flags);
s_serializedPropertyValueAccessorsDict.Add(kvp.Key, propertyInfo);
}
}
static GUIContent IconContent(string name, string tooltip)
{
var builtinIcon = EditorGUIUtility.IconContent (name);
return new GUIContent(builtinIcon.image, tooltip);
}
static GUIContent TempContent(string text)
{
s_tempContent.text = text;
return s_tempContent;
}
static void DeleteArrayElementAtIndex(SerializedProperty arrayProperty, int index)
{
var property = arrayProperty.GetArrayElementAtIndex(index);
// if(arrayProperty.arrayElementType.StartsWith("PPtr<$"))
if(property.propertyType == SerializedPropertyType.ObjectReference)
{
property.objectReferenceValue = null;
}
arrayProperty.DeleteArrayElementAtIndex(index);
}
public static object GetPropertyValue(SerializedProperty p)
{
PropertyInfo propertyInfo;
if(s_serializedPropertyValueAccessorsDict.TryGetValue(p.propertyType, out propertyInfo))
{
return propertyInfo.GetValue(p, null);
}
else
{
if(p.isArray)
return GetPropertyValueArray(p);
else
return GetPropertyValueGeneric(p);
}
}
static void SetPropertyValue(SerializedProperty p, object v)
{
PropertyInfo propertyInfo;
if(s_serializedPropertyValueAccessorsDict.TryGetValue(p.propertyType, out propertyInfo))
{
propertyInfo.SetValue(p, v, null);
}
else
{
if(p.isArray)
SetPropertyValueArray(p, v);
else
SetPropertyValueGeneric(p, v);
}
}
static object GetPropertyValueArray(SerializedProperty property)
{
object[] array = new object[property.arraySize];
for(int i = 0; i < property.arraySize; i++)
{
SerializedProperty item = property.GetArrayElementAtIndex(i);
array[i] = GetPropertyValue(item);
}
return array;
}
static object GetPropertyValueGeneric(SerializedProperty property)
{
Dictionary<string, object> dict = new Dictionary<string, object>();
var iterator = property.Copy();
if(iterator.Next(true))
{
var end = property.GetEndProperty();
do
{
string name = iterator.name;
object value = GetPropertyValue(iterator);
dict.Add(name, value);
} while(iterator.Next(false) && iterator.propertyPath != end.propertyPath);
}
return dict;
}
static void SetPropertyValueArray(SerializedProperty property, object v)
{
object[] array = (object[]) v;
property.arraySize = array.Length;
for(int i = 0; i < property.arraySize; i++)
{
SerializedProperty item = property.GetArrayElementAtIndex(i);
SetPropertyValue(item, array[i]);
}
}
static void SetPropertyValueGeneric(SerializedProperty property, object v)
{
Dictionary<string, object> dict = (Dictionary<string, object>) v;
var iterator = property.Copy();
if(iterator.Next(true))
{
var end = property.GetEndProperty();
do
{
string name = iterator.name;
SetPropertyValue(iterator, dict[name]);
} while(iterator.Next(false) && iterator.propertyPath != end.propertyPath);
}
}
static bool ComparePropertyValues(object value1, object value2)
{
if(value1 is Dictionary<string, object> && value2 is Dictionary<string, object>)
{
var dict1 = (Dictionary<string, object>)value1;
var dict2 = (Dictionary<string, object>)value2;
return CompareDictionaries(dict1, dict2);
}
else
{
return object.Equals(value1, value2);
}
}
static bool CompareDictionaries(Dictionary<string, object> dict1, Dictionary<string, object> dict2)
{
if(dict1.Count != dict2.Count)
return false;
foreach(var kvp1 in dict1)
{
var key1 = kvp1.Key;
object value1 = kvp1.Value;
object value2;
if(!dict2.TryGetValue(key1, out value2))
return false;
if(!ComparePropertyValues(value1, value2))
return false;
}
return true;
}
struct EnumerationEntry
{
public SerializedProperty keyProperty;
public SerializedProperty valueProperty;
public int index;
public EnumerationEntry(SerializedProperty keyProperty, SerializedProperty valueProperty, int index)
{
this.keyProperty = keyProperty;
this.valueProperty = valueProperty;
this.index = index;
}
}
static IEnumerable<EnumerationEntry> EnumerateEntries(SerializedProperty keyArrayProperty, SerializedProperty valueArrayProperty, int startIndex = 0)
{
if(keyArrayProperty.arraySize > startIndex)
{
int index = startIndex;
var keyProperty = keyArrayProperty.GetArrayElementAtIndex(startIndex);
var valueProperty = valueArrayProperty.GetArrayElementAtIndex(startIndex);
var endProperty = keyArrayProperty.GetEndProperty();
do
{
yield return new EnumerationEntry(keyProperty, valueProperty, index);
index++;
} while(keyProperty.Next(false) && valueProperty.Next(false) && !SerializedProperty.EqualContents(keyProperty, endProperty));
}
}
}
public class SerializableDictionaryStoragePropertyDrawer : PropertyDrawer
{
public override void OnGUI(Rect position, SerializedProperty property, GUIContent label)
{
property.Next(true);
EditorGUI.PropertyField(position, property, label, true);
}
public override float GetPropertyHeight(SerializedProperty property, GUIContent label)
{
property.Next(true);
return EditorGUI.GetPropertyHeight(property);
}
}
